1.4 - Differences Between WordPress.org and WordPress.com
Understanding the distinction between WordPress.org and WordPress.com is crucial in grasping the true potential of the WordPress development platform. While both share a common roots and offer powerful tools for website creation, their core differences significantly influence how users approach web development. WordPress.org, often dubbed the “self-hosted” version, grants complete control over your website’s design, plugins, and hosting environment. It’s an open canvas for those seeking customisation and scalability.
Conversely, WordPress.com provides a more streamlined experience, ideal for beginners or those who prefer a hassle-free setup. It includes hosting and maintenance within a single package, but limits certain customisation options unless you upgrade to premium plans. Here’s a quick comparison:
- Access to extensive plugins and themes (WordPress.org)
- Built-in hosting and simplified management (WordPress.com)
- Greater flexibility for e-commerce and advanced features (WordPress.org)

2.4 - Custom Post Types and Taxonomies
Within the intricate tapestry of the wordpress development platform, the ability to tailor content through custom post types and taxonomies elevates website craftsmanship from mere design to storytelling. These key components unlock a realm of organisation and specificity, allowing developers to craft content that resonates deeply with targeted audiences. Instead of being confined to traditional posts and pages, custom post types act as bespoke content containers—think portfolios, testimonials, or event listings—each with their own unique structure.
Taxonomies, on the other hand, serve as the organisational backbone, categorising and tagging content with refined precision. They transform a cluttered digital landscape into a well-orchestrated symphony, ensuring visitors find what they seek effortlessly. For instance, a real estate site might utilise custom taxonomies like property types and neighbourhoods, creating an intuitive navigation experience that feels both natural and immersive.

4.1 - Security Best Practices
Security remains the silent guardian of any robust digital presence, especially within the intricate ecosystem of the WordPress development platform. While the platform’s flexibility and user-friendly nature are undeniable, they can also be vulnerabilities if not properly managed. A meticulous approach to security best practices is essential to thwart malicious attacks and safeguard sensitive data.
Effective security begins with prioritising updates—keeping WordPress core, themes, and plugins current ensures that known vulnerabilities are patched promptly. Implementing strong, unique passwords and multi-factor authentication creates an initial barrier that is hard to breach. Additionally, regular backups act as a safety net, allowing quick restoration in case of an incident.
For a comprehensive shield, consider deploying security plugins that offer real-time monitoring and firewall protection. These tools serve as an extra layer of defence, scrutinising traffic for suspicious activity and blocking potential threats before they reach your website.

4.2 - Performance Optimization
Performance optimisation is the secret sauce that transforms a good WordPress site into a blazing fast, user-friendly experience. Every millisecond saved can significantly boost user engagement and search engine rankings. Within the WordPress development platform, efficiency isn’t just about speed — it’s about creating a seamless digital journey that keeps visitors hooked. By fine-tuning your site’s performance, you ensure it remains resilient under traffic surges and delivers content with minimal delay.
One of the most effective strategies involves leveraging caching mechanisms and content delivery networks (CDNs). These tools distribute your website’s assets closer to your visitors, reducing load times and server strain. Additionally, optimising images and scripts can shave precious seconds off page load speeds. For complex sites, employing a robust database optimisation routine can also prevent sluggishness caused by bloated data tables. The goal is to streamline every element within your WordPress development platform so that it runs like a well-oiled machine.
To further enhance performance, consider implementing a structured approach using an ordered list:
- Regularly update themes, plugins, and the core WordPress software to patch vulnerabilities and improve efficiency.
- Utilise lazy loading techniques for images and videos to defer non-essential assets.
- Minify CSS, JavaScript, and HTML files to reduce file sizes and accelerate load times.

5.4 - Headless WordPress and Decoupled Architecture
The future of the wordpress development platform is set to undergo a radical transformation with the rise of headless architecture and decoupled systems. This approach separates the content management backend from the front-end presentation layer, allowing developers to craft highly customised, lightning-fast digital experiences. Unlike traditional WordPress setups, which tightly couple the backend with the visual interface, headless WordPress enables seamless integration with various front-end frameworks, providing greater flexibility and scalability.
For those eager to embrace this evolution, understanding the core tenets is essential. A headless WordPress setup leverages the REST API to serve content to diverse platforms—be it websites, mobile apps, or IoT devices. This decoupling not only boosts performance but also unlocks innovative possibilities for immersive digital ecosystems. As more developers adopt this architecture, expect to see a surge in dynamic, interactive interfaces that adapt fluidly across devices.
Key trends in this realm include:
- Enhanced content delivery through API-first design.
- Greater emphasis on personalised user experiences.
- Integration of modern JavaScript frameworks like React, Vue, or Angular.
